This work presents a novel approach to comparing and graphically representing simultaneous concentration measurements of PM10, PM2.5 and PM1 (i.e., aerosol particles with aerodynamic diameters less than 10, 2.5 and 1 mu m, respectively) with similar data reported in the literature using PM2.5/PM10 and PM1/PM10 concentration ratios. With this aim, a dedicated triangular diagram was used. The proposed approach was applied to size-segregated particulate matter (PM) concentrations recorded in the Agri Valley (Basilicata region - southern Italy). Results show that the PM10, PM2.5 and PM1 concentrations recorded in the Agri Valley are comparable both in terms of PM concentration ratios and PM levels to an urban site.
